Selection process

The scheme is administered as a verification-led process rather than a competitive pitch, and it follows four broad steps.

  • Application submission: an enterprise that qualifies under IDP 4.0 files its Net SGST Reimbursement application with the designated department of Andhra Pradesh Industries.
  • Documentation: the file typically has to carry proof of the unit's Sub-Large or Large status, its SGST payment records, annual turnover statements, and details of its eligible Fixed Capital Investment. The exact formats and checklists are set out in the official policy guidelines.
  • Review and verification: the department examines the application to confirm eligibility and to validate the claimed SGST amount, the turnover figures and the FCI details. Financial statements may be scrutinised and site visits may form part of this stage.
  • Approval and disbursement: once verification is complete and the claim is approved, reimbursement is released on an annual basis for five years, continuing only while the enterprise remains eligible and performs as claimed.
